Why You'll Love It

These all-natural duck legs include both the leg and thigh, offering rich flavor, tender meat, and unmatched versatility. With excess fat trimmed and cut by professional butchers, they’re ideal for slow cooking methods that transform the meat into something deeply savory and fall-apart tender.

Raised humanely on family farms, Jurgielewicz ducks are fed a corn- and soybean-based diet with no antibiotics or added hormones, resulting in clean, robust flavor. Duck legs shine when cooked low and slow—perfect for classic confit, oven roasting, or smoking.

A standout option for family meals, gatherings, or anyone looking to explore duck beyond the breast.

How to Cook

  • Baking
  • Roasting

Thaw in the refrigerator and pat dry. Season generously with salt and pepper.

Place legs in a single layer in a casserole dish and add a small amount of duck fat or cooking oil. Set oven to 300°F (no need to preheat) and cook for 90–120 minutes until tender. Increase oven temperature to 400°F and cook an additional 10–15 minutes until golden and crisp.

For extra crispiness, transfer legs to a baking sheet and broil briefly. Rest 10–15 minutes before serving.

How to Defrost

  • Cook Now

    Thin cuts and small portions can be cooked straight from frozen — no thawing needed.

  • Quick Thaw (<30 min)

    Keep sealed and place in cold water, changing every 30 minutes until thawed.

  • Larger Cuts (1–2 hours)

    Use the cold water method for roasts or bigger pieces to thaw safely and faster.

  • Best Results

    Thaw in the refrigerator 24–48 hours ahead for the best texture and flavor.
